What happens along a divergent boundary?​

Geography
1 answer:
Akimi4 [234]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

A divergent boundary occurs when two tectonic plates move away from each other. Along these boundaries, earthquakes are common and magma (molten rock) rises from the Earth's mantle to the surface, solidifying to create a new oceanic crust. When two plates come together, it is known as a convergent boundary.
